The Problem We Solve: Unexpected Repairs, Damage and Breakdowns Cost Thousands
South African homeowners and businesses face unpredictable repair and maintenance costs for appliances, equipment, landscape and other immovable assets that degrade, get damaged or break down. These costs can range from R500 for a simple plumbing fix to R15,000 or more for a major appliance replacement or electrical failure. Landscape neglect costs homeowners thousands in garden rehabilitation after seasonal damage. Zibuke OnCall eliminates these unexpected costs with a single, predictable monthly subscription.
Emergency Repair Costs vs Zibuke OnCall Subscription
| Service / Issue Type | Typical Emergency Repair Cost | Zibuke OnCall Protection Plan |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Electrician Callout | R600 to R1,500 | Included in Electrical Plan (R2,900/yr) |
| Emergency Plumber Callout | R500 to R3,500 | Included in Plumbing Plan (R3,300/yr) |
| Washing Machine Repair | R800 to R3,500 | Included in Appliance Plans (from R259/mo) |
| Fridge Compressor Replacement | R2,500 to R7,000 | Included in Appliance Plans (from R259/mo) |
| Geyser Replacement & Fitment | R4,000 to R12,000 | Included in Plumbing Plan (R3,300/yr) |

Two Accountability Systems: One for Candidates, One for Employees
1. The Accountability Assessment (for Candidates)
Every person who joins Zibuke OnCall β whether Sales Manager, Sales Representative, Intern, Technician, or Driver β must prove they are accountable before they are permanently hired. The assessment is not a test. It is a demonstration. Sales candidates must sell 45 active subscriptions. Technicians must complete 48 repairs without callback. Drivers must complete 70 collection and delivery jobs on time. If they succeed, they are hired permanently. If they fail, they are released with what they earned.
2. The Accountability Score (Bars) (for Employees)
After passing their assessment, employees earn bars for exceeding their monthly targets. Bars determine their annual bonus. Sales representatives earn 1 bar per package sold above 20 per month. Sales managers earn 1 bar per 3 extra packages sold above target by their team. Both systems are tracked automatically and displayed in each employee's portal.

The Payment Pause Difference: We Only Charge You When You Need Us
For monthly plans: your payment is paused after the first month if you have not used the service, and resumes only after your first repair. For annual plans: your payment is paused if you have not used the service, and resumes only after your first repair. Your service stays active even when your payment is paused. You can still book oncall, request repairs, and use all portal features.
Month 1
Pay and subscribe. Your plan is active.
Month 2 Onwards
Payment paused if no service used. Service stays active.
When You Need Us
Payment resumes. Repair is completed. You only pay when you use it.
This is our accountability to you: we will not take your money if we are not providing you with value.
